云主机是一种基于云计算技术的虚拟化主机服务,通过将物理服务器资源划分为多个虚拟机实例,实现多租户共享资源的方式来提供计算能力。在云计算领域,有一种特殊的云主机类型被称为Swap云主机。本文将介绍Swap云主机的概念、特点以及使用场景。
什么是Swap云主机?Swap云主机是一种特殊的云主机,其特点是可以使用交换空间(Swap Space)来扩展内存容量。交换空间是一种虚拟内存技术,将磁盘空间用作内存的延伸,当物理内存不足时,可以将部分数据交换到磁盘上,以释放物理内存供其他进程使用。
Swap云主机的特点1. 内存扩展能力:Swap云主机可以通过使用交换空间来扩展内存容量,从而满足对内存需求较高的应用程序的运行要求。
2. 成本效益:相比于增加物理内存的成本,使用Swap云主机可以更加经济高效地扩展内存容量。
3. 灵活性:Swap云主机可以根据实际需求动态调整交换空间的大小,从而灵活地管理内存资源。
4. 可靠性:Swap云主机在物理内存不足时,可以通过将部分数据交换到磁盘上来避免系统崩溃或进程被终止。
Swap云主机的使用场景1. 内存密集型应用:对于一些内存密集型的应用程序,如大数据处理、机器学习等,内存容量的需求可能会超过物理服务器的实际内存大小。使用Swap云主机可以满足这类应用程序对内存的高要求。
2. 临时性内存需求:对于一些临时性的内存需求,如应急情况下的内存扩展、临时测试环境等,使用Swap云主机可以快速、灵活地满足这些需求,而无需增加物理内存。
3. 资源共享:Swap云主机可以通过交换空间的方式,实现多租户之间的资源共享,提高资源利用率,降低成本。
问:Swap云主机与传统云主机有何区别?答:Swap云主机与传统云主机的区别主要在于内存扩展方式的不同。传统云主机的内存容量是固定的,无法动态扩展。而Swap云主机可以通过使用交换空间来扩展内存容量,从而满足对内存需求较高的应用程序的运行要求。
问:Swap云主机有哪些优势?答:Swap云主机的优势主要体现在内存扩展能力、成本效益、灵活性和可靠性方面。通过使用交换空间来扩展内存容量,Swap云主机可以满足对内存需求较高的应用程序的运行要求。相比于增加物理内存的成本,使用Swap云主机可以更加经济高效地扩展内存容量。同时,Swap云主机可以根据实际需求动态调整交换空间的大小,从而灵活地管理内存资源。在物理内存不足时,Swap云主机可以通过将部分数据交换到磁盘上来避免系统崩溃或进程被终止。
问:Swap云主机适合哪些应用场景?答:Swap云主机适合内存密集型应用、临时性内存需求以及资源共享等场景。对于一些内存密集型的应用程序,如大数据处理、机器学习等,内存容量的需求可能会超过物理服务器的实际内存大小。使用Swap云主机可以满足这类应用程序对内存的高要求。对于一些临时性的内存需求,如应急情况下的内存扩展、临时测试环境等,使用Swap云主机可以快速、灵活地满足这些需求,而无需增加物理内存。此外,Swap云主机还可以通过交换空间的方式,实现多租户之间的资源共享,提高资源利用率,降低成本。
总结来说,Swap云主机是一种可以使用交换空间来扩展内存容量的特殊云主机。它具有内存扩展能力、成本效益、灵活性和可靠性等特点,适用于内存密集型应用、临时性内存需求以及资源共享等场景。通过使用Swap云主机,用户可以更加灵活地管理内存资源,满足对内存的高要求,并提高资源利用率,降低成本。